Flanges are integral components in various industries, serving as vital connectors for pipes, valves, pumps, and other equipment. They facilitate the assembly and disassembly of piping systems, allowing for maintenance, inspection, and modifications. Understanding the different types of flanges and their specific applications is crucial for selecting the appropriate flange to ensure system integrity and efficiency.
Types of Flanges and Their Applications
1. Weld Neck Flange
Weld Neck Flanges are characterized by a long, tapered hub that provides reinforcement to the connection, making them suitable for high-pressure and high-temperature applications. The flange is butt-welded to the pipe, ensuring a smooth transition and reducing stress concentrations. This design minimizes turbulence and erosion, making it ideal for critical services.
Applications:
- High-pressure pipelines in oil and gas industries
- Chemical processing plants
- Power generation facilities
- Marine applications
2. Slip-On Flange
Slip-On Flanges have a bore slightly larger than the pipe’s outer diameter, allowing the pipe to slip into the flange before welding. They are fillet welded both inside and outside to provide sufficient strength. These flanges are easier to align and install, making them a cost-effective choice for low-pressure applications.
Applications:
- Low-pressure fluid transportation
- Cooling water lines
- Fire-fighting systems
- Process piping in industries
3. Socket Weld Flange
Socket Weld Flanges feature a socket into which the pipe is inserted and then fillet welded. They are typically used for small-diameter, high-pressure piping. The smooth bore and good flow characteristics make them suitable for applications where internal cleanliness is important.
Applications:
- High-pressure steam lines
- Hydraulic systems
- Chemical processing
- Gas lines
4. Threaded Flange
Threaded Flanges have internal threads that match the external threads of the pipe. They are used in systems where welding is not feasible or desirable, such as in explosive environments. Threaded flanges are suitable for low-pressure and low-temperature applications.
Applications:
- Utility services like air and water
- Fire protection systems
- Explosive atmospheres
- Temporary connections
5. Blind Flange
Blind Flanges are solid discs used to close off the end of a piping system or vessel. They allow for easy access to the interior of a line or vessel once it has been sealed. Blind flanges can withstand high pressure and are also used for pressure testing.
Applications:
- Pressure vessel closures
- Manhole covers
- Inspection ports
- Testing of piping systems

6. Lap Joint Flange
Lap Joint Flanges are used in conjunction with a stub end, which is butt-welded to the pipe, while the flange itself is not welded or fixed to the pipe. This design allows the flange to rotate freely, facilitating easy alignment of bolt holes during assembly. Lap joint flanges are ideal for systems requiring frequent disassembly.
Applications:
- Systems requiring frequent maintenance
- Low-pressure applications
- Non-critical services
- Piping systems with limited space
7. Long Weld Neck Flange
Long Weld Neck Flanges are similar to weld neck flanges but have an extended neck, which acts as a boring extension. They are typically used in place of a weld neck flange and a piece of pipe for bolt-up connections to vessels or columns.
Applications:
- Pressure vessels
- Heat exchangers
- Column connections in process plants
- High-pressure applications
8. Reducing Flange
Reducing Flanges are used to connect pipes of different diameters. They have a flange with one specified diameter and a bore of a different, usually smaller, diameter. This allows for a smooth transition between pipes of varying sizes.
Applications:
- Connecting different pipe sizes
- Flow control systems
- Process piping
- Pump inlet and outlet connections
9. Orifice Flange
Orifice Flanges are used in conjunction with orifice meters to measure the flow rate of liquids or gases in a pipeline. They have provisions for meter connections and are typically used in metering systems.
Applications:
- Flow measurement in pipelines
- Metering systems in process industries
- Custody transfer systems
- Energy management systems
10. Spectacle Blind Flange
Spectacle Blind Flanges consist of a connected pair of discs, one solid and the other with a hole, resembling a pair of spectacles. They are used to either block or allow flow in a pipeline by rotating the assembly.
Applications:
- Maintenance operations
- Safety procedures
- Isolation of piping sections
- Process control
Industries Using Flanges
Oil and Gas Industry
The oil and gas sector extensively uses flanges in drilling, refining, and transportation pipelines. High-pressure and temperature-resistant flanges, such as weld neck and blind flanges, are commonly used.
Chemical Industry
Chemical processing plants use corrosion-resistant flanges to handle aggressive chemicals. Materials such as stainless steel and alloy flanges are preferred.
Power Generation
Power plants require durable and heat-resistant flanges for steam and cooling water systems. Weld neck, socket weld, and slip-on flanges are widely used.
Water Treatment
Flanges play a crucial role in water distribution and wastewater treatment facilities, where they connect pumps, valves, and pipes.
Construction Industry
Flanges are used in structural piping systems in commercial and industrial buildings, offering secure connections for HVAC, plumbing, and fire protection systems.
